Columbia Law School Society for Immigrant and Refugee Rights The Society for Immigrant and Refugee Rights (SIRR) is a student run organization at Columbia Law School.

SIRR is dedicated to promoting a dialogue about the rights of refugees and immigrants in the United States and globally. We sponsor guest panels, organize career forums, advocate for increased immigration-related opportunities at Columbia Law School, and administer three pro bono projects (African Services Committee Project, Immigration Advocacy Project, and Iraqi Refugee Assistance Project) throughout the year.
